The goods lift at Westerbrook House is reserved for deliveries and should not be used for passenger travel, even during busy periods. Assistants expecting a large delivery should notify the loading dock team the day before so the bay can be cleared. Couriers must stay with their trolleys at all times. The lift call panel on the dock level is locked outside delivery hours and requires the code below.

turnstile pass: bdg-TXR-4

## Deploying the Gatewick Proctor Queue

Deploys are pretty painless: push to main, wait for the pipeline, then watch the queue drain dashboard for five minutes. If candidates pile up mid-exam, roll back first and ask questions later — the queue replays safely. Everything the workers care about lives in one config block, shown here for reference.

settings of bafof-yagef:
JOROX_PIN=8740
JOROX_TENANT=pelox
JOROX_METRICS_HOST=metrics.jorox.qorvelworks.internal
JOROX_SEAL=seal_c78f63c1
JOROX_STANDBY_TEAM=norax

## Autocomplete Index Notes

The autocomplete index on Quillbrook's search service rebuilds hourly, and reviewers should know it lags behind writes by up to ten minutes. When reviewing changes to the suggester module, assume stale results in staging and don't flag them as bugs. The rebuild job runs on the tindermere-worker pool and is throttled to avoid contention with the main query path. Builds are signed before promotion, and the key used for that signature is shown below.

release key, fajef-kajeg: bky19_LdLu6Ne6FLi8he2c24d

Hello plugin authors,

The Checkmill validator plugin interface has reached release candidate. Notable changes: validators now declare their input schemas explicitly, async validation is supported natively, and the deprecated context object has been removed. Existing v2 plugins will continue to load through the compatibility shim for two more cycles. Please test your plugins against the candidate and report regressions through the usual tracker. When reporting, match your environment against the build token below.

pipeline stamp: htk4_ae36